Not sure if this has been discussed yet or not, but is anyone else curious what the impact of "tunneling" the new 45/69 behind the GRB will have on the Green/Purple lines? Theyre gonna have to construct a bridge for the lines, and a possible method for this would be to build one half of the bridge so that there's still one line to connect Eado to Downtown, but since there isn't a "switch" on the West side of 69, trams headed West won't be able to cross over (where the line splits by the new GRB Garage) to the Capitol side of the line. If they can't do that, then they can't turn around and head East back towards Eado. I guess they could construct a temporary line by making a sharp S-curve immediately West of Eado Stadium Station, and run the lines parallel to the current ones on Texas Ave, then make the turn Southwest and connect it to the current lines. This would require shutting down Texas Ave, which in itself is a huge issue, but then there's the cost of this whole proposal. Either way, service on the Green/Purple line is going to be...lacking in the coming years. Honestly, they're probably just going to use the Switch they built West of Eado Stadium Station and just shut off service for a year or so while they build the bridge over the new Freeway.
